K. Rajendra Kumar visits Udhampur, Reasi, SKPA; Addresses police durbars

Jammu , 21 Dec 2016

Director General of Police (DGP), K. Rajendra Kumar today underscored the need for transparency in the day-to-day functioning of police to bring about a positive change in the public perception about the force. He said that the cops have to be more dedicated towards their noble service to the people by providing justice.Mr. Rajendra was addressing the cops at police durbars in Police Training Centre Talwara, District Police Lines Udhampur, Reasi and Sher-e-Kashmir Police Academy (SKPA) today. He said that JKP with its dedication and desire of sacrifice has succeeded in bringing normalcy in the State and the force needs strenuous efforts to bring about more improvement in its functioning. Men in field are the representatives of police parivar and their   performance is always judged by the people. We have to keep the expectations of the people and work together for safeguarding the interests of the people and the State.DGP said that the force has faced many challenges during past 27 years on various fronts and the situations have been dealt with courage and confidence. Cooperation of the people have always encouraged our personnel in dealing the challenging situations and the force has to improve its capabilities and bring visible changes in the working. 

Adopting new methods of policing, the cops are prepared for upcoming challenges, said the DGP. He reiterated that people’s cooperation is of vital importance and we have to gain public confidence to strengthen bonds with them.Mr. Rajendra appreciated the jawans and officers for their bravery in maintaining peace and order in the State. He said that our men have exhibited maximum restrain to avoid collateral damages and saved human lives while fighting the militants. He said that our primary duty is to serve the people and ensure safety of their lives and property of the citizens.During the visit, DGP also interacted with the senior police officers of the Range and discussed the functioning of their respective units. He was told that coordinated efforts have been put in place to improve the functioning of the force at different fronts and an efficient mechanism of supervision has been formulated to ensure good policing and better deliverance.Mr. Rajendra was accompanied by IGP SKPA, Mr Rajesh Kumar, IGP (Jammu Zone), Danish Rana, DIG, Udhampur-Reasi Range, Surinder Gupta, SSP Udhampur, Shalinder Mishra, SSP Reasi, Tahir Sajad Bhat, Principal STC Talwara, Jehangir Khan, Additional SsP, Mohan Lal Kaith, Sanjay Singh Rana and other police officers of the Range.
